titleOfInvention |
An Advertisement Click-through Rate Prediction Method Based on Cost-sensitive Classifier Ensemble |
abstract |
The invention discloses a method for predicting the click-through rate of advertisements based on the integration of cost-sensitive classifiers. The improved B-SMOTE+ method is used for data oversampling in the rate prediction; the data set after data preprocessing is passed to the classifier for learning, and the cost-sensitive algorithm is used to increase the punishment for the mistake of "clicking on the advertisement"; The genetic algorithm is used to optimize the parameters; the two-layer Stacking method is used to integrate. The present invention solves the problems of low accuracy rate of some current click-through rate prediction algorithms due to fewer feature dimensions, inadequate data preprocessing and the like, and adopts the method to better improve the accuracy rate of advertisement click-through rate prediction. |
